Abstract

The utility model discloses an air humidifying device suitable for a fresh air system, which comprises a mounting plate, wherein the front end of the mounting plate is fixedly connected with a main shell, and the front end of the main shell is provided with a front protection panel; the inner wall of the mounting plate is fixedly connected with a positioning pipeline, the center of the main shell is fixedly connected with a fixed partition plate, and the center of the fixed partition plate is provided with a humidifying mechanism; a water containing box is placed in the center of the bottom of the main shell, and a rectangular hole corresponding to the water containing box is formed in the front end of the top of the fixed partition plate; the center that the screw thread mount pad is many installs into water pipe, the top of main casing body outer wall one side is installed and is constructed the corresponding control panel of humidification. The utility model can humidify the blown air at the tail end of the ventilation pipeline of the fresh air system by designing the simple air humidifying mechanism and the simple flow guide structure, thereby realizing the integral humidification of the indoor air, changing the indoor air environment and greatly improving the working efficiency.

Background
The fresh air system is used for sending fresh air to the indoor space by special equipment on one side of the indoor space, and then the fresh air is discharged to the outdoor space from the other side of the indoor space by the special equipment, so that a fresh air flow field can be formed indoors, and the requirement of indoor fresh air ventilation is met. The implementation scheme is as follows: the new wind flow field is formed in the system by adopting a high wind pressure and large flow fan, supplying air from one side to the indoor by means of mechanical strength and discharging the air from the other side to the outdoor by a specially designed exhaust fan. The air entering the room is filtered, disinfected, sterilized, oxygenated and preheated while the air is supplied.
In winter, the air is relatively dry, and the fresh air can accelerate the drying of indoor air after the processing such as filtration, sterilization and dehumidification gets into indoorly, and the dry air not only can bring the discomfort for indoor people, also can influence indoor staff's mood simultaneously, and the humidification effect of some indoor small-size humidifiers is limited, can't change indoor holistic air circumstance.

Detailed Description
The following detailed description of the preferred embodiments of the present invention, taken in conjunction with the accompanying drawings, will make the advantages and features of the utility model easier to understand by those skilled in the art, and thus will clearly and clearly define the scope of the utility model.
Referring to fig. 1 and 2, an air humidifying device suitable for a fresh air system includes a mounting plate 1, a main housing 2 is fixedly connected to a front end of the mounting plate 1, and an air inlet through hole is formed at a top of a center of the mounting plate 1, so that a ventilation duct of the fresh air system can be inserted into the main housing 2 through the air inlet through hole; the mounting plate 1 and the main shell 2 are of an integrated structure, and mounting holes are formed in the corners of the mounting plate 1, so that the integrated structure is simple and firm in design and convenient to mount and fix; as shown in fig. 5, the front protection panel 3 is mounted at the front end of the main housing 2, the front protection panel 3 includes a panel main body 301, an air outlet grille 302 is disposed at the top of the center of the front end of the panel main body 301, and a flow guide plate 303 is fixedly connected to the center of the rear end of the panel main body 301; part of the water mist intercepted by the air outlet grille 302 is gathered and condensed by the guide plate 303 and then enters the water containing box 7 through the rectangular hole 8;
as shown in fig. 4, the inner wall of the mounting plate 1 is fixedly connected with a positioning pipeline 4, the positioning pipeline 4 is welded and fixed on the inner wall of the mounting plate 1, and the positioning pipeline 4 can position and limit the ventilation pipeline inserted into the main casing 2; the center of the main shell 2 is fixedly connected with a fixed clapboard 5, the center of the fixed clapboard 5 is provided with a humidifying mechanism 6, the humidifying mechanism 6 comprises a humidifier main body 601, and the bottom of the humidifier main body 601 is provided with a water absorption cotton strip 602; the humidifying mechanism 6 adopts a detachable structure design, and the humidifying mechanism 6 with the detachable structure design not only has simple structure and is convenient for quick installation and fixation, but also is convenient for quick disassembly when a fault occurs or cleaning is needed; the bottom end of the water absorbent cotton strip 602 is inserted into the center of the water containing box 7 and extends to the bottom of the water containing box 7, so that the water absorbent cotton strip 602 can fully absorb clean water contained in the water containing box 7, the clean water is atomized and sprayed out by using the humidifier main body 601, and then the fresh air blown out from the ventilation pipeline is blown into a room, so that the indoor air is humidified;
as shown in fig. 3, a water containing box 7 is placed in the center of the bottom of the main housing 2, and a rectangular hole 8 corresponding to the water containing box 7 is formed at the front end of the top of the fixed partition plate 5;
as shown in fig. 4, a screw thread mounting seat 9 is arranged on one side of the outer wall of the main casing 2, a water inlet conduit 10 is arranged in the center of the screw thread mounting seat 9, and a control panel 11 corresponding to the humidifying mechanism 6 is arranged on the top of one side of the outer wall of the main casing 2; the water inlet pipe 10 and the thread mounting seat 9 are screwed and fixed through threads, so that the water inlet pipe 10 can be mounted and fixed, and meanwhile, the quick mounting and dismounting are facilitated; one side of the outer wall of the water containing box 7 is provided with a round hole corresponding to the water inlet pipe 10, and one end of the water inlet pipe 10 penetrates through the round hole and extends towards the center of the water containing box 7, so that a water source externally connected with the water inlet pipe 10 can be directly injected into the water containing box 7 through the water inlet pipe 10.
When the air humidifying device is used, the air humidifying device is installed and fixed at the position of an air outlet of a ventilation pipeline of a fresh air system, the ventilation pipeline is inserted into the main shell 2 through the air inlet through hole, a water source externally connected with the water inlet pipe 10 can be directly injected into the water containing box 7 through the water inlet pipe 10, the humidifying mechanism 6 is installed at the center of the fixed partition plate 5, the bottom end of the water absorbing cotton strip 602 is inserted into the center of the water containing box 7 and extends to the bottom of the water containing box 7, the water absorbing cotton strip 602 can fully absorb clean water contained in the water containing box 7, so that the clean water is atomized and sprayed out by the humidifier main body 601, and then the fresh air blown out from the ventilation pipeline is blown into a room, so that the indoor air is humidified, and part of water mist intercepted by the air outlet grille 302 is gathered and condensed by the guide plate 303 and then enters the water containing box 7 through the rectangular hole 8.
